Eye Wash Stations - Essential for Workplace Safety

Eye wash stations are crucial safety features in any environment where workers might be exposed to hazardous chemicals, dust, or other potentially harmful materials. Whether you’re working in a laboratory, factory, or construction site, having a eye wash station nearby can be the difference between a minor irritation and a serious injury. These stations provide immediate relief in the event of an eye injury, allowing workers to flush out harmful substances quickly and effectively.
Why Eye Wash Stations Are Important
In workplaces where chemicals, gases, or debris are present, the risk of eye injury is always a concern. Even minor exposure to certain substances can cause discomfort, irritation, or permanent damage to the eyes. An eyewash station allows workers to immediately flush their eyes with clean water or saline solution, helping to minimize the damage caused by these substances.
It’s essential that these stations are easy to locate and accessible to all workers in case of emergency. By providing a safe and efficient way to deal with eye injuries, eye wash stations help prevent long-term health issues and ensure compliance with workplace safety regulations.
Types of Eye Wash Stations
There are several different types of eye wash stations to meet the needs of various work environments. Some of the most common types include:
- Plumbed Eye Wash Stations: These are permanent fixtures that are connected to a water supply. They are typically installed in high-risk areas where regular exposure to harmful substances is likely. They provide a continuous flow of water to thoroughly rinse the eyes.
- Self-Contained Eye Wash Stations: These units do not require plumbing and are often portable. They contain a reservoir of sterile water or saline solution, making them ideal for workplaces that do not have access to running water or where mobility is necessary.
- Portable Eye Wash Stations: These are smaller, lightweight units that can be moved around easily. They are perfect for construction sites or temporary workspaces where traditional plumbed units may not be feasible.
- Eye Wash Bottles: For smaller jobs or remote work areas, eye wash bottles provide an easy-to-carry option for quick rinsing. While not as comprehensive as full stations, they are a handy emergency option.
Each type of eye wash station offers a different set of benefits depending on the specific needs of your workplace. It’s important to choose the right one to ensure that you can respond quickly to any emergency.
How to Use an Eye Wash Station
Knowing how to use a eye wash station properly is crucial in an emergency situation. Here are the general steps to follow when using an eye wash station:
- Activate the Station: If using a plumbed station, pull the lever or push the button to start the flow of water. If using a self-contained unit, remove the protective cover and activate the water flow.
- Position Yourself: Position your face in the stream of water, making sure your eyes are fully immersed. Open your eyes wide and allow the water to rinse them thoroughly.
- Flush for 15 Minutes: For maximum effectiveness, continue flushing your eyes for at least 15 minutes. This will help remove all contaminants and minimize the risk of damage.
- Seek Medical Attention: After flushing, it’s important to seek medical attention immediately, especially if the injury was caused by a chemical or other harmful substance.
Having eye wash stations available and properly maintained is crucial for ensuring worker safety. Regular checks should be performed to ensure that the stations are functioning correctly and that the water or solution is fresh.
Benefits of Eye Wash Stations
- Immediate Relief: Eye wash stations provide immediate treatment for eye injuries, helping to reduce the severity of the injury and prevent long-term damage.
- Compliance with Regulations: Having eye wash stations in the workplace is often a legal requirement in industries where workers are exposed to hazardous substances.
- Prevention of Eye Damage: By flushing harmful materials out of the eyes quickly, eye wash stations can prevent permanent damage to the cornea or retina.
- Easy Access: Eye wash stations are designed to be easily accessible, ensuring that help is available within seconds of an injury.
Eye wash stations are a simple but vital safety measure in workplaces that involve exposure to chemicals, dust, or other potentially harmful substances. By providing immediate relief in case of eye injury, they help protect workers and prevent long-term health issues. Whether you choose a plumbed, self-contained, or portable unit, ensuring that these stations are available and maintained is essential for workplace safety.
